13,544,239,348,261,888 is an even composite number composed of four pr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 13544239348261888 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 4 prime factors (large circles) and 924 divisors.

13544239348261888 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of nine hundred twenty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 13544239348261888:

210 × 76 × 172 × 733

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 17 × 17 × 73 × 73 × 73)

    This is a very rough estimate, based on a speaking rate of half a second every third order of magnitude. If you speak quickly, you could probably say any randomly-chosen number between one and a thousand in around half a second. Very big numbers obviously take longer to say, so we add half a second for every extra x1000. (We do not count involuntary pauses, bathroom breaks or the necessity of sleep in our calculation!)
